Inhibitors | Comment | Organism | Structure |
---|---|---|---|
8-methoxymethyl isobutylmethylxanthine | 20 microM, 8-MM-IBMX, a selective PDE1 inhibitor, no effect on either JG cell cAMP content or renin release compared to untreated controls | Mus musculus | |
isobutylmethylxanthine | 100 microM, a nonselective PDE1 inhibitor, increases cAMP and renin relase by 72% and 118%, respectively | Mus musculus | |
N-(6-Aminohexyl)-5-chloro-1-naphthalenesulfonamide | W7, 10 microM, a calcium-calmodulin inhibitor | Mus musculus | |
vinpocetine | 40 microM, selective PDE1 inhibitor | Mus musculus |
